Kinds Of UK Driving Licenses
The UK offers various classifications of driving licenses based on the kind of car that people wish to run. Understanding these categories is necessary for both brand-new drivers and those seeking to upgrade their existing licenses. The main types include:

Full Driving License: This is the most common type of license, enabling people to drive automobiles and other motor vehicles.
Provisionary Driving License: This is released to brand-new drivers who have used to take their driving test. It allows students to drive under specific conditions (e.g., accompanied by a certified driver) while they get ready for their driving test.
Motorcycle License: This permits individuals to run motorcycles. The motorcycle license can further be partitioned into:
- AM: Moped license
- A1: Light bike license
- A2: Medium motorbike license
- A: Full motorbike license for bigger bikes
Industrial Driving License: For those who plan to drive commercial cars, such as buses or heavy goods cars (HGVs). These licenses need additional endorsements and training.
Driving License for Special Vehicles: This consists of licenses for particular car types like tractors or particular kinds of agricultural equipment.
Requirements for Obtaining a UK Driving License
1. Age Requirement
To request a provisional driving license in the UK, a specific should be at least 17 years of ages. However, one can obtain a license at 16 if planning to drive a moped.
2. Residency and Identification
Candidates should be residents of the UK and offer identification. Acceptable types of ID include:
- Passport
- Birth certificate
- National Identity Card
3. Medical Fitness
Applicants should state if they struggle with any medical conditions that may impact their ability to drive. Some conditions need a medical checkup or alert to the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A).
4. Passing the Theory Test
Before obtaining a useful driving test, candidates must pass a theory test. This test evaluates knowledge of the Highway Code, road indications, and safe driving practices. It includes:
- A multiple-choice section
- A threat understanding test
5. Practical Driving Test
As soon as the theory test is passed, prospects can schedule a useful driving test. This assessment assesses a person's driving skills behind the wheel and guarantees they can operate buy a driver license vehicle safely in numerous conditions.
6. Application Process
Finally, individuals should complete a driving license application and pay the applicable fee. This kind can be completed online driver license or through paper applications offered at post offices.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How long does it take to get a driving license in the UK?
The time it requires to get uk driving licence a driving license varies from individual to individual. After obtaining the provisional license, it typically takes several months to learn and get ready for the tests. The process might take longer for those who fight with the theoretical or useful elements.
2. Can I drive immediately after passing my test?
- Full Driving License: Yes, you can drive as quickly as you've passed your practical driving test, provided you have your complete driving driver's license online.
- Provisional Driving License: If you have a provisionary license, you need to still follow the rules (e.g., having actually a qualified driver accompanying you till you pass).
3. Can I drive in other countries with a UK driving license?
Yes, a UK driving license is normally acknowledged in many countries worldwide. Nevertheless, it is a good idea to check the requirements for the specific nation, as some may require an International Driving Permit (IDP) in addition to the UK license.
4. What should I do if I lose my driving license?
If a driving license is lost, the person should report it to the DVLA as quickly as possible and request a replacement license online licence driving or by submitting a paper form. This usually requires a cost.
5. Can I drive if I have a medical condition?
Numerous medical conditions can impact a person's ability to drive. It is important to inform the DVLA about any diagnosis that might hinder safe driving. The DVLA will evaluate each case on an individual basis, and driving may be limited or momentarily banned until medical physical fitness is verified.
